Cats Distinguish Between Speech Directed at Them and Humans

Neuroscience News - 25 Oct 2022 23:31
Cats Distinguish Between Speech Directed at Them and Humans Cats alter their behavior when their owner speaks in a cat-directed tone toward them, but not when their owner talks to another human or when a stranger addresses them in a cat-directed tone. Evidence suggests cats are able to, and do form strong bonds with their owners.
